Summary:In this article we propose to discuss the quality of employment in SMEs in Romania. We have debated the role of small and medium-sized enterprises in the Romanian economy, public policy proposals to create an ecosystem that promotes transformation of structure, resilience and development in SMEs, the presentation of the situation of the SME sector at the regional level, the evolution of the innovation typology, 2010-2012, the major difficulties faced by SMEs. In order to have an overview and to answer a series of questions about the quality of occupation in the Romanian SMEs, and their perspective, we have performed a radiography of some works from the field of international experience.
